Ver Mensaje Individual
  #4 (permalink)  
Antiguo 24/02/2004, 05:25
josemi
Ex Colaborador
 
Fecha de Ingreso: junio-2002
Mensajes: 9.091
Antigüedad: 21 años, 10 meses
Puntos: 16
Hola,

Primero, debes tener permisos de esa web para poder coger los datos directamente de su HTML. Que la pagina este en internet solo quiere decir que permiten a las personas a ver esos datos en esa URL. Cualquier otro uso debe ser bajo permiso de esa web.

Segundo, hay webs que tienen un interfaz para que los programas accedan directamente a sus datos. Por ejemplo las API de Google permiten realizar consultas automatizadas al buscador de google (con ciertas limitaciones), Amazon tambien tiene un servicio parecido.

Tercero, tu "problema". Son dos pasos: leer la pagina HTML; y parsear ese HTML. Para leer la pagina puedes usar fopen() (www.php.net/fopen) o fsockopen() (www.php.net/fsockopen). En ambos paginas hay ejemplos con URLs. Y para parsear el HTML, podrias usar expresiones regulares, o usar alguna clase que ya lo parsee (mira en http://pear.php.net o www.phpclasses.org)

Saludos.
__________________
Josemi

Aprendiz de mucho, maestro de poco.